There are two ways to send money to an inmate at the Elyria City Jail. Firstly, you can send money online by following the instructions provided on the official website of the Elyria City Jail at http://www.cityofelyria.org/department/police/faq/. Secondly, you can send money by mail to the address 18 WEST AVE, Elyria, Ohio 44035. It is important to ensure that the inmate's full name and identification number are included in the mail to facilitate the processing of the funds.
